Why do genuine denim tears seem the way such tears do?
Authentic tears reflect denim's twill structure, indigo dye behavior, and the tension points of natural movement. The blue warp yarns break first, leaving pale weft strands plus a soft fade halo around that damage. Chemicals plus laser distress might mimic the visual, but they seldom replicate fiber-level properties or the garment-wide aging story.
Classic denim is one 3x1 right-hand twill with indigo-dyed warp (vertical) yarns plus undyed ecru crosswise (horizontal) yarns. Blue pigment sits on fabric surface, so wear removes color via stages, producing fading gradients instead rather than on/off contrasts. During real stress, vertical yarns snap as segments and show horizontal weft spans that fuzz and feather over wear. Ring-spun yarns display slub irregularities, creating uneven wear designs that don't duplicate like a print. When someone creates damage, the perimeter often looks excessively clean, too uniform, or chemically tinted instead of weathered and softened by use.
Method 1 — Natural edge fade and feathering
Real tears show a soft, gradual transition from darker blue to pale blue to natural, with feathery tiny fibers radiating from the edge. Fake distress tends to have ensemble denim tears a hard, consistent outline, an sudden color jump, plus a yellow-orange tint from oxidizing chemicals.
Look closely at the tear edge for a \\"halo\\" of fade plus micro-fray, not a sharp boundary. Anyone should see brief, uneven cotton fibers and tiny fractured warp ends extending outward, not some smooth cut line. Run your thumb across; the edge should feel airy and dry, rather than crispy or stiff. Chemical sprays like potassium permanganate may leave a bronze or mustard hue and crunchy hand, especially where that spritz pooled. If the edge glints under light plus looks slightly glazed, heat or resin set might have been used to fake aging.
Way 2 — Do the tear directions and yarns align up with fabric weave?
Authentic holes usually show horizontal white weft bridges, fractured blue warp ends, and a angled twill \\"ghost\\" still remains coherent near the damage. Extended, clean vertical slits and identical rips across both sides suggest fabrication.
Follow the weave ribs with naked eyes; genuine distress won't disrupt that diagonal rhythm uniformly. In real leg blowouts, you'll discover staggered warp fractures and lots with short white horizontal spans crossing the gap. Factory cutting cuts or machine-made holes tend in the direction of run too straight and too vertical, with little or no weft fuzz. If a vendor claims \\"years containing wear\\" but you can't find these signature horizontal cream strands, be doubtful. Zoom in within photos: irregular, inconsistent yarn thickness shows a good indicator; parallel, laser-scorched small dots or precisely repeated slashes stay not.
Method 3 — Damage map that follows human movement
Authentic aging forms where bodies articulate and items rub—front thighs, knees, back pockets, belt line, cuff backs, and coin pocket corners. Perfect symmetry or distress in low-stress zones is a red flag.
Expect whiskers that radiate from this crotch toward both hips, not straight ruler lines. Around the knees, creases stack at a slight angle then compress where each leg bends, often with darker blue islands between lighter creases. Pocket borders fray where hands pull; watch pouches and phone shapes leave asymmetric stress marks. Heel drags and cuff blowouts concentrate at the rear hem, not the front. Should you see paired mid-shin holes across both legs, and a thigh hole without supporting damage in the surrounding area, someone faked the tear.
Method 4 — Will there chemical or laser processing tells?
Machine distressing leave pixel-like dot patterns, perfectly symmetrical whiskers, and surface \\"burned\\" fades; synthetic distress leaves discoloration, crunchiness, and color that doesn't fade naturally. Your touch, nose, and one small light will catch both.
Look for repeating, geometric whiskers or creases—real creases never carbon-copy from either side to right. Under raking illumination, laser work can show a pixelated raster, like small dots. Potassium permanganate and bleach can bronze or tint the fade plus sometimes leave a faint chemical smell; resin-baked 3D whiskers feel stiff and springy instead compared to soft. If this tear edge is darkened in some straight, even line with no fine fraying, it's likely artificial set rather compared to worn.
Professional Tip: A inexpensive UV flashlight should reveal chemical distress. Under UV light, bleach and chemically processed zones often glow brighter than adjacent indigo, while authentic abrasion stays fairly dull and irregular. Check edges, whiskers, and knee wear in a unlit room; inconsistent fluorescence is a tell. Keep the light a short space away and compare multiple areas so you don't mistake random lint plus detergent residue.
Method 5 — Mending, thread work, and thread aging
Authentic repairs show varied stitch spacing, mellowed thread fuzz, plus color that had mellowed with light exposure and washes. Vivid, slick polyester covering a supposedly aged tear, or decorative darning with minimal surrounding wear, can't add up.
Inspect darning density plus direction; vintage repairs wander with human hand, and yarn tension varies. Natural thread on aged repairs will fuzz slightly and fade in tone, while fresh polyester catches light and keeps too crisp. Should there's sashiko plus patchwork, the repair fabric should additionally bear compatible aging and edge wear, not brand-new distinction with a perfect inside. Around a repair, you need to see bruised indigo and softened texture from handling; sterile repairs floating within a sea of dark, unfaded fabric are a staging clue. At tension points like pouch corners, a legitimate bartack may get blown or softened; perfect factory-fresh reinforcements next to old rips are suspect.
Method 6 — Metal components, hem roping, and compartment bags
Authentic aging never isolates itself to a single hole; rivets patina, hem stitching ropes, and pocket bags thin. A major tear with pristine hardware, flat bottoms, and crisp pocketing is a inconsistency.
Check copper studs for verdigris plus abrasion rings, plus shank buttons for softened edges with finish loss at the high points. Chain-stitched hems, particularly on unsanforized and heavier denim, create \\"roping\\" as that fabric and thread shrink differently, creating diagonal ridges; flat, untextured hems with big knee tears rarely coexist. Flip the jeans fully out: pocket bags should show wear, pilling, or minor holes where one phone or objects rubbed. Leather patches darken, dry, then crack with age; a minty label on \\"heavily worn\\" jeans is clear tell. On self-edge pairs, inspect this ID line; it should soften and fuzz, not seem factory-starched next to battlefield-level rips.
Method 7 — Can the person prove this timeline?
Demand for dated aging photos, original acquisition details, and detailed close-ups; real distress has a record you can verify. Inconsistencies in aging, metadata gaps, and recycled images show warning signs.
Request inside-out shots showing the tear and the surrounding fabric structure to see fiber behavior. Use inverse image search in order to ensure photos are not lifted from websites or brand accounts. If the person claims selvedge and a specific factory or model, check lot tags, washing labels, arcuate design, and button/rivet identifications against known documentation. Compare measurements—width, inseam, thigh—versus the brand's sizing behavior; authentic long-term wear typically exhibits subtle shrink at the inseam and a measured side seam twist on RHT twill. A honest seller can explain when and the way each tear happened and supply one consistent series of images across months.

Fact 1: Indigo represents a surface colorant with low yarn penetration, so genuine abrasion fades starting at the outside inward and leaves distinctive gradients that artificial processes struggle to replicate convincingly.
Reality 2: Chain-stitched cuffs rope because the stitch and fabric shrink at different rates, twisting the edge; denim to has \\"years of wear\\" but minimal roping rarely aligns with the story.
Fact 3: Right-hand weave tends to rotate the outseam ahead over time; that gentle twist represents a quiet however reliable indicator indicating true wear and repeated laundering.
Fact 4: Artificial distress often produces tiny, evenly spaced \\"pixels\\" visible using raking light; once you see the dot matrix, you can't unsee this.
